Me he propuesto a realizar bases de datos en access 97 pero quiero que estas sean ejecutables, que se puedan instalar en otro equipo que no tenga este programa, que sea independiente de acce Que cuando abra mi aplicación no se abra access
Access no puede crear aplicaciones ejecutables, así que lo que intentas hacer es imposible. Lo más cercano que puedes hacer para crear aplicaciones ejecutables es programarlas en Visual Basic y abrir tu base de datos de Access desde ahí, una vez que hagas esto, puedes utilizar el asistente para distribución y crear un ejecutable listo para instalar. PERO, toda la funcionalidad que tiene Access no la tendrás en Visual Basic (Filtros, Vista formulario/hoja de datos, etc.). En realidad, Access NO ES el mecanismo de base de datos en sí, es MICROSOFT JET, Access es solo un administrador de tus datos. Tu puedes crear una BD solo con tablas y consultas de Access, y usar como "interfaz" la que tu desees: Access, Visual basic, ASP, etc., es por eso que cuando usas los dos últimos, no necesitas tener instalado el Access en tu equipo, pero eso sí, Access tiene más herramientas para manejar tus datos de las que carecen los otros dos, por eso casi siempre todo mundo deja tanto su aplicación en Access como sus datos también en Access. Por eso, siempre al diseñar una base de datos, trata de diseñarla de forma que se puedan separar los datos de la aplicación, así será más fácil llevar tu aplicación a otra plataforma y lograremos que esa otra aplicación abra los mismos datos. Espero te haya quedado un poco más claro este tema.